Output 51fc7aaae7bb68dfc482bc5b59edbc83a0d1258cb33dd5127fa4f4f7801a1e95:3

value
3145402
script pubkey
OP_0 OP_PUSHBYTES_20 4ed3a9f1a8e47aae68c50ed7b2cfafd431c46e6c
address
bc1qfmf6nudgu3a2u6x9pmtm9na06scugmnv88zfl5
transaction
51fc7aaae7bb68dfc482bc5b59edbc83a0d1258cb33dd5127fa4f4f7801a1e95
confirmations
202875
spent
true